Tunisia - Palm Oil Demand
Since 2014, Tunisia Palm Oil Demand fell by 7.8%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 85 among other countries in Palm Oil Demand at 48 Thousand Metric Tons. Tunisia is overtaken by Romania, which was number 84 at 49 Thousand Metric Tons and is followed by Morocco at 42 Thousand Metric Tons. Indonesia ranked the highest with 11,684 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, a decrease of 10.8% versus 2018. India, Malaysia and China resp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Myanmar recorded the best 5 years average growth at +137.8% per year, while Uzbekistan was the worst growing country at -31.7% per year.
